Subject: ScanLane cut-over complete

Hi support team,

The migration from the legacy Orbwick scanner bridge to ScanLane finished last night without rollback. All dock readers at the Fernholt depot now report through the new service, and reconciliation against yesterday's counts matched exactly. If customers report scan failures, please reference the live settings, which are as follows.

settings of yageg-yahap:
[gorael]
team = olieth
access_code = ac_941d74
owner = brieth.aldiel
host = gorael.tolvaqio.internal
port = 6379
peer = briwyn.urlaqtech.internal
salt = 116e6622
pin = 1957

Handover: DocSweep linter. I'm off Project Marlin; Priya owns this now. DocSweep runs on every docs PR, flags broken anchors and stale frontmatter. Rules live in the repo, service itself runs on the Kestrel cluster. Don't touch the parser fork. New folks: start by reading the values below.

deployment values, tafof-taduf:
pelius:
  pin: 6508
  tenant: praiel
  seal: seal_4e33a2f4
  metrics_host: metrics.pelius.plorvagrid.corp
  standby_team: druix
  escalation: juldor-norius
  nonce: 5db598

Confirmed that the incoming sample consignment from the Keldon facility arrives in two insulated cases, each with a tamper tag and a temperature logger. Receiving staff should photograph both tags before opening, download the logger data within the first hour, and store vials in rack order per the enclosed manifest. Any discrepancy gets flagged to the Keldon liaison before processing begins. At the dock itself, the courier exchange must follow the confidential instruction given below:

handover note for yagef-bagep: the drudor pelius courier leaves the kasdor zorvan norir ledger at gate 8016 under passcode 755406

Discount Policy for Large Deals (Managers Only)

For orders above 250 units of the Varno platform, branch managers may approve discounts up to 12% without central sign-off. Anything beyond that goes to Tilda Roske in commercial operations. Stacking promotional credits on top of the large-deal rate is not permitted. These thresholds tie directly to next year's margin targets, which are noted below.

internal memo for kahop-yajof: The steering committee signed off on a budget of $12.6 million for Project Jorwyn. The renewal with Quenoxox Logistics closes at $16.8 million a year, 48 percent above the last contract.